Storing your wine properly preserves its flavor. Temperatures to any extreme can damage your wine’s taste. Keep the wines between 50 and 55 degrees to get optimal results. There are refrigerators designed to store wine, or perhaps your basement is cool enough.

Don’t be afraid of sulfite warnings. American manufacturers often have warning labels concerning sulfates, but in reality all wines have them. While it is possible for sulfites to cause allergic reactions, there is no need to worry if this has not been a problem in the past.

You always want to serve white wines at about forty five degrees for the best taste. Whenever you drink these wines at room temperature, it’s not possible to enjoy the complete flavor that they can provide. When you put the champagne in the fridge about 2 hours before it will be served, you will really notice the difference.

A lot of people want to drink wine after dinner, try a dessert wine. Terrific dessert wine choices include Champagnes, Port and Moscato from Italy. Relax with your guests by the fire with a delicious glass of dessert wine.
